US Vice President JD Vance spoke out about his cousin Nate’s service in Ukraine.
Nate Vance was a former US Marine who fought for Ukraine from 2022 to 2025. He belonged to the Da Vinci Wolves First Motorized Battalion, a volunteer unit that helped defend Ukraine against Russia.
JD Vance said he didn’t talk publicly about Nate’s service because he wanted to keep him safe. “I didn’t want to endanger his life more than it already was,” he told Fox News.
Nate Vance recently met with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ky and criticized US policy on Ukraine. He also spoke out against JD Vance’s past comments, which Nate felt were not supportive of Ukraine.
JD Vance responded by saying he had no interest in arguing with his cousin publicly. However, he did take issue with Nate’s attempt to contact him through his Senate office instead of going through their family members, who JD Vance is close to.
Nate Vance left Ukraine shortly before the US presidential inauguration because he was afraid of being captured by Russian forces. He said it had become too complicated and risky for him to stay in Ukraine.
JD Vance has previously spoken out against Ukraine and President Zelensky, repeating some ideas that are similar to those of the Kremlin.
